I know I can't change the way I look. But maybe, just maybe, people can change the way they see...
For younger readers, the unforgettable story of August Pullman and Wonder reimagined in this gorgeous picture book.
With spare, powerful text and richly-imagined illustrations, We're All Wonders shows readers what it's like to live in Auggie's world - a world in which he feels like any other kid, but he's not always seen that way.
We're All Wonders taps into every child's longing to belong, and to be seen for who they truly are. It's the perfect way for families and teachers to talk about empathy, difference and kindness with young children.
